The Loyoda Folding Walker is a lightweight, durable mobility aid designed for seniors and individuals with leg injuries. Featuring 5-inch front wheels for versatile terrain handling, it offers 8 height adjustments for personalized comfort. The trigger release folding mechanism ensures easy transport, while the included storage bag adds convenience for daily outings.

Green For Legs?
UPDATE 08.27.24I have take the walker outside for shopping, doctors, and miscellaneous. The walker’s wheels are starting to wobble & the whole walker has a light shake. The wheels tend to have a hard time getting over sidewalk cement breaks. This various - obviously - with the depth and width of the break. I am not going to change my stars for now.I did not know that walkers have a color code to them. This is my third walker over the past 1-½ years. Sidewalks and streets just eat up the wheel axils. This one is a different brand so maybe it will last longer.Assembly is straight forward with no tools required. - just patience and guessing at times. The first step is a test on putting the backbar on. Swing out the arms and slide the bar on. But there is something inside the arm that prevents the bar from going all the way in - then magic - in slides on. If you don’t know “how many holes” you need for the front wheels and rear stand, it will take a few tries to get the proper hight. I have heard two schools of thought: 1 - Top rail @ your wrist and 2 - Top rail @ your waist. I don’t think it matters much as long as you are standing up straight & walking with he walker and not pushing it. The walker has a bag that attaches with Velcro to the front. The pockets are rather small & I don’t think it will be very useful - I wouldn’t put my wallet or phone in it. The walker is not very deep and may be an issue on longer walks or even on short walks.This is another item that is hard to review without using it for awhile. Indoors should be OK except for thick carpet/shag and throw rugs. Outside you ned to use it on sidewalks, street crossings, and other outdoor surfaces. Just using it on my tile floor, the walker has a shake to it - it is not a smooth walk. The walker has two break handles which are used to fold the walker. Other styles of walkers - 4 wheals seated, e.g. - that use these types of handles are used for breaks to stop the walker. This could be a possible is when/if folks use both style of walkers.Without more usage, and with the wobble, depth, and handles take the walker down to 3 Stars which is a “C”.
